VPN认证失败问题排查与解决方案指南(网络工程师视角)

hjs7784 2026-01-31 翻墙加速器 3 0

在现代企业网络架构中,虚拟私人网络(VPN)已成为远程办公、分支机构互联和数据安全传输的核心工具,用户常遇到“VPN认证失败”这一常见错误提示,不仅影响工作效率,还可能暴露潜在的安全隐患,作为一名网络工程师,我将从故障现象出发,系统性地分析可能导致认证失败的原因,并提供可操作的排查步骤与解决方案。

明确“认证失败”的含义:它通常指客户端无法通过服务器的身份验证,即用户名或密码错误、证书不匹配、会话超时或策略限制等问题,这类问题往往不是单一因素造成,而是涉及客户端配置、服务端策略、中间设备(如防火墙)及网络连通性等多个层面。

第一步:确认基础网络连通性
确保客户端能访问到VPN服务器IP地址,使用ping命令测试是否可达,若不通,需检查路由表、ACL规则或中间防火墙策略是否阻断了UDP 500/4500(IKE)、TCP 1723(PPTP)等关键端口,特别注意,部分ISP对某些端口进行限速或屏蔽,建议改用SSL-VPN(基于HTTPS的Web接入)替代传统IPSec方案。

第二步:核实账号与密码
最常见的原因就是用户输入错误,请务必区分大小写,同时确认账户未被锁定或过期,如果是域账户,请检查Active Directory同步状态,以及用户所属组是否有访问权限,对于双因素认证(2FA)环境,还需确保手机验证码或硬件令牌正常工作。

第三步:检查证书与密钥配置
若使用证书认证(如EAP-TLS),必须确认客户端安装了正确的CA证书,且服务器证书未过期,可通过浏览器访问VPN门户查看证书信息,对比本地信任链是否完整,证书颁发机构(CA)若更换或吊销旧证书,也会导致认证中断,需及时更新并重新部署。

第四步:审查服务器端策略
登录到VPN网关(如Cisco ASA、FortiGate或华为USG),查看日志文件(如syslog或auth.log)定位具体错误码(如“Invalid credentials”、“Certificate validation failed”),同时检查RADIUS服务器(如Microsoft NPS)是否响应正常,数据库连接是否稳定,若采用LDAP集成认证,需验证目录服务是否可访问。

第五步:排除中间设备干扰
防火墙、负载均衡器或代理服务器可能拦截或修改流量,某些设备会强制重定向HTTP请求至非标准端口,导致SSL-VPN握手失败,建议临时关闭这些设备上的安全策略,逐步缩小问题范围。

第六步:客户端软件兼容性
不同操作系统(Windows、macOS、Linux)对VPN协议的支持存在差异,若使用第三方客户端(如OpenVPN、StrongSwan),请确保版本与服务器匹配,必要时,卸载重装客户端或切换为厂商原生工具(如Cisco AnyConnect)以排除兼容性问题。

建立标准化运维流程至关重要,建议部署集中式日志监控系统(如ELK Stack),实时捕获认证失败事件;定期开展渗透测试与权限审计,防患于未然。

“VPN认证失败”看似简单,实则考验网络工程师对全链路的理解能力,唯有系统化排查、精细化配置,才能保障远程访问的安全与稳定。

VPN认证失败问题排查与解决方案指南(网络工程师视角)